Vladimir Kozikov,开发商,下诺夫哥罗德,下诺夫哥罗德州,俄罗斯
Vladimir is available for hire
Hire Vladimir

Vladimir Kozikov

Verified Expert  in Engineering

iOS Developer

Location
Nizhny Novgorod, Nizhny Novgorod Oblast, Russia
Toptal Member Since
January 14, 2016

Vladimir是一名iOS软件开发者,他为苹果移动设备开发应用已经5年多了,开发应用的经验也超过了8年. 良好的背景和沟通技巧,加上强烈的责任感,使他很容易适应任何规模的项目和团队.

Availability

Part-time

Preferred Environment

Git, Xcode

The most amazing...

...我开发的是一个即时通讯基础设施,由一个自定义后端运行,重点是一个简洁和技术的iOS客户端.

Work Experience

iOS Developer

2021 - 2021
Sync (via Toptal)
  • 加入一款智能服务的iOS开发团队,帮助用户控制血糖水平,保持健康.
  • 实现了新的复杂功能,如具有丰富交互和自定义功能的漂亮图表).
  • 在应用程序中添加了分析功能,以查看用户如何与之交互,使其更加用户友好.
Technologies: Swift, iOS, Charts, Analytics

iOS Developer

2020 - 2020
BookSniffer (via Toptal)
  • 为一项服务开发了一个应用程序,将图书作者与读者联系起来.
  • 集成了各种Firebase工具(云数据库、深度链接、通知等).).
  • 创建了一个云同步逻辑,减少了Firebase调用,从而降低了使用成本.
Technologies: Firebase, Swift, iOS

Lead iOS Developer

2018 - 2019
MERA
  • 在一个汽车项目中领导一个由四人组成的iOS开发团队.
  • Collaborated directly with the PM on the customer side.
  • 修复了遗留代码中导致意外崩溃的架构相关问题.
  • 集成了高级API调用,可分几个步骤自动处理错误并重复失败的请求.
Technologies: Crashlytics, Realm, iOS, Swift, Objective-C

Senior iOS Developer

2017 - 2018
Intech
  • 使用现代iOS模式和MVVM、RxSwift等技术开发了一款音乐流媒体应用.
  • Refactored a legacy project to fix performance issues.
  • 重新设计UI以正确支持大屏设备.
  • 优化的逻辑,以减少CPU使用和电池消耗时,应用程序在后台.
  • Fixed several non-trivial OS related issues.
技术:Crashlytics, RxSwift, Model View ViewModel (MVVM), AVFoundation, Core Animation, Swift

iOS Developer

2017 - 2017
Clipo (via Toptal)
  • Contributed to creating modern UI basing on Sketch mockups.
  • 实现图像和视频编辑和输出功能.
  • Developed logic to add animations to images and videos.
  • Worked with both Swift and Objective-C code.
技术:AVFoundation, Core Animation, Swift, Objective-C

iOS Developer

2015 - 2016
MERA
  • 开发并修复了一个使用Facebook和Twitter sdk以及基于rest的后端Swift应用程序的错误.
  • 在从另一个团队接收的项目中执行代码清理,使其清晰并符合OOP原则. Profoundly changed the outdated UI to make it contemporary.
  • 在Swift上重写了几个遗留的Objective-C模块,并升级到新的库,以便在新项目中使用.
  • Contributed to the development of a WebRTC-based project. Wrote a sketchy Node.js server to simplify testing.
  • Participated in the development, from scratch, 专注于无线扬声器的iOS设备音乐服务客户端.
Technologies: REST, iOS, Swift, Objective-C

C# .NET Developer

2011 - 2015
MERA
  • 加入一个VoIP通信项目的国际开发团队,该项目使用Microsoft Lync/Skype for Business API和相关环境.
  • Worked using Agile/Scrum methodologies.
  • 在大量错误修复和新特性开发的范围内改进了项目代码库.
  • 优化UI,使其在每个平台和环境下都能看起来很棒.
  • 为项目管理运行了几个新特性的演示.
  • 因对项目的责任和成就获得“最佳员工杰出贡献奖”.
Technologies: C++

Resica

应用于iOS拍摄自定义分辨率的照片并保存到库.

Telebroom

http://github.com/vkozikov91/Telebroom-iOS
Messenger应用基础设施,目前由iOS客户端(Swift)和Node组成.js (JavaScript) server. 它不是一个准备好大规模部署的严格产品,因为最初它是一个测试不同框架和体系结构如何协同工作的平台. 然而,它已经逐渐成长为一个相对成熟的项目.

Beeline.Music (via Intech)

音频流媒体应用程序,听取数以千计的正版曲目, add them to a library, create custom playlists, and much more.

Noteman iOS App

Noteman是一个笔记管理器,用户可以在其中添加带有图像和麦克风录音的文本笔记,并在其他iOS设备上访问它们. From a technical standpoint, the project uses common iOS features like Core Data, Core Animation, Core Graphics, networking, multithreading, and Facebook and Twitter integration. Noteman与由Google的Firebase支持的自定义REST后端进行交互.

Social Networks Aggregator (via MERA)

基于swift的应用程序,允许用户通过不同的社交网络帐户登录,从感兴趣的人那里获取内容, like posting, commenting, and more.

Our team was responsible for integrating official Facebook, Twitter and Instagram SDKs, 通过REST与服务器端交互的逻辑开发, 以及与设计师就UI的进一步实现进行协作.

iOS Application for Car Rental Clients (via MERA)

针对司机和租车人的iOS应用程序,可以帮助他们快速找到附近的加油站或露营地. In addition, it provides videos, articles, 以及其他在驾车穿越美国时可能非常有用的建议. 该应用程序是用Objective-C编写的,并使用谷歌地图SDK.

BookSniffer for iOS

iOS应用程序,用于连接图书作者和读者的服务. It provides functionality to search for books, add them to your library, rate, share, 并获得最新的折扣和新闻关于你最喜欢的作家.
2013 - 2015

Master's Degree in Information Systems And Technologies

Nizhny Novgorod State Technical University n.a. R.E. Alekseev - Nizhny Novgorod

2009 - 2013

Bachelor's Degree in Information Systems

Nizhny Novgorod State Technical University n.a. R.E. Alekseev - Nizhny Novgorod, Russia

Libraries/APIs

Core Animation, RxSwift, Node.js

Tools

Xcode, Git, Crashlytics

Languages

Swift, Objective-C, C++, JavaScript

Paradigms

REST,敏捷软件开发,模型-视图-视图模型(MVVM)

Platforms

iOS, Firebase

Frameworks

Core Data

Storage

Realm

Other

AVFoundation, WebSockets, Charts, Analytics

Collaboration That Works

How to Work with Toptal

在数小时内,而不是数周或数月,我们的网络将为您直接匹配全球行业专家.

1

Share your needs

在与Toptal领域专家的电话中讨论您的需求并细化您的范围.
2

Choose your talent

在24小时内获得专业匹配人才的简短列表,以进行审查,面试和选择.
3

Start your risk-free talent trial

与你选择的人才一起工作,试用最多两周.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ring